Abstract

A concise route to macrolactone 38, an advanced intermediate of the Nicolaou/Chen synthesis of palmerolide A, is described. Key steps in our synthesis include a Noyori transfer hydrogenation of an alkynone, chain extension via Claisen rearrangement, and an ADH reaction on an enyne. After reduction of the triple bond, a selective silylation served to differentiate the hydroxy­ groups of the diol, which allowed for the preparation of aldehyde 30 containing already the carbamate function. A HWE reaction produced the substrate for an intramolecular Heck coupling. In contrast to the Stille cyclization, the Heck cyclization produced only the desired 14E,16E-diene. Elaboration of the C-19 side chain led to the key lactone 38.
